MAKE HIP HOP NOT WAR!

Tuesday Apr 24, 9PM @ 2640 (2640 St. Paul St.)

An amazing concert with independent Hip Hop artists from around the country, coming together to build opposition to the continuing occupation of Iraq. With performances by:

plus testimony against the occupation from Cindy Sheehan from Gold Star Families For Peace, Iraq Vets Against the War and Military Families Speak Out, and with Rev. Lennox Yearwood of the Hip Hop Caucus as MC.

Red Emma's is open Monday through Friday from 10AM-10PM, Saturday from 10AM-8PM, and Sunday from 10AM-6PM. Our weekly collective meetings are Sunday at 7PM, and are open to anyone interested in the project, except for the first Sunday of every month, which is closed to everyone except collective members.
Red Emma's is part of IU 660 of the Industrial Workers of the World, one of the only unions to recognize that worker collectives can stand in solidarity with those fighting the bosses as part of one big union.
